Output d5c38c22a4732b6dda79d1bc79594d194e2b65165cc4ccb5e559fbfe8eabebb8:0

value
43443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1237c26fe5bd60f0ad95a876277976a5fee1bf7b OP_EQUAL
address
33MLtEeNqP5fVwSNYpCiLp9hdDM7PnDb56
transaction
d5c38c22a4732b6dda79d1bc79594d194e2b65165cc4ccb5e559fbfe8eabebb8
confirmations
335005
spent
true